Title: The Innovations of Hans-Jurgen Bestmann
Introduction
Hans-Jurgen Bestmann is a notable inventor based in Erlangen,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of technology, particularly in the area of radiation-sensitive materials. His work has been recognized through the granting of a patent, showcasing his innovative spirit and technical expertise.
Latest Patents
Hans-Jurgen Bestmann holds a patent for a radiation-sensitive resist composition comprising a diazoketone. This invention is crucial for advancements in various applications, particularly in the semiconductor industry. His patent portfolio includes 1 patent, reflecting his focused contributions to innovation.
Career Highlights
Bestmann is currently employed at Siemens Aktiengesellschaft, a leading global technology company. His role at Siemens allows him to work on cutting-edge projects that push the boundaries of technology. His expertise in radiation-sensitive materials has positioned him as a valuable asset within the company.
Collaborations
Throughout his career, Hans-Jurgen Bestmann has collaborated with esteemed colleagues, including Michael Sebald and Siegfried Birkle. These partnerships have fostered an environment of innovation and have led to the development of advanced technologies.
